Over the 12 years from 2014 to 2025, Calvert County recorded 599 distinct power outage events, averaging 2.1 hours per event.

The single worst outage on record in Calvert County started January 3, 2022 (Winter Storm), lasting 76 hours and leaving up to 12,581 customers without power (18% of the county) at its peak.

July has historically been the worst month for outages in Calvert County, with 73 events recorded during that month across the dataset.

Based on this history, Calvert County earns a Reliability Grade of B, placing it in the 76th percentile nationally for grid reliability (higher percentile = more reliable).
